Quantum Efficiency Measurement

Photovoltaic devices are so called since they rely upon the photovoltaic effect that was first discovered by a French experimental physicist, Edmund Becquerel, in 1839 to generate a current/voltage upon exposure to light. However, the history of practical PV devices did not begin until 1954 when Bell Laboratory first demonstrated a silicon solar cell with a conversion efficiency of 6%. Sciencetech Pv Solar Cell Testing - Quantum Efficiency Measurement System (PTS-2-QE) allows for SR, QE and IV measurements with user friendly software. The system includes a main xenon arc lamp, monochromator with automated order sorting filters, a steady-state solar simulator Class AAA bias light source, IV tester, reference detector, measurement electronics, computer, and all software required to measure solar cell characteristics. The PTS-2-QE system provides users with a light tight sample chamber for all measurements. There is also an optional upgrade for IQE measurements. Shielded and light tight test area enclosure has convenient removable cover allowing access from top, front and sides.
The PV Cell Testing System performs:
• Induced Voltage (IV) : VOC , ISC, Rshunt, Pmax, efficiency %, and fill factor
• Spectral Response : 250 - 2500 nm scanning range
• Quantum Efficiency
• Photocurrent measurement : Resolution 10 picoampere to 10 microampere.
• IQE measurement upgrade available
• Monochromatic light power up to 125 mW
• Keithley 2400 series source meter
• Stanford SR800 series lock-in amplifier
• Light-tight measurement chamber
• Manually controlled shutter
• Bias voltage range of 0 to 200 V
• User-friendly software for data acquisition
